Cost

The cost of replacing your lost car key can differ. It depends on the type of key you have and the place where you buy it. The condition of the key as well as the locksmith's additional services could affect the price. For example, if your key is damaged from the beginning it will be necessary to pay for repairs prior to getting the replacement. If you also want to use a service that offers warranties or guarantees, you will have to pay an additional fee for these.

Traditional keys are easy to copy and can be purchased from the hardware store for $10. If your key is equipped with chip or transponder that is, then you'll have to visit an auto dealer or locksmith. The majority of these keys are priced between $150 and $300. The location of your vehicle and the model and make can be a factor in the cost.

In home improvement and hardware shops kiosks make it simple to copy the most common types of keys: office and house keys. Auto keys on the other hand, are more complicated to copy. They have sophisticated security features and automation. For this reason, you'll probably need to visit an auto store or locksmith to have your copy copied.

Another option is to go to your local locksmith shop, who can cut and program your spare car key for an affordable price than you'd pay at a dealer. The only drawback is that it might take some time to locate one. But, it's worth a look if you have a unique key or one that's not common.
